Customize the OS X workspace | Mac OS X. Quick quiz: Do you still have your Dock at the bottom of your desktop (where OS X puts it by default)? Do you still use only the icons that came with the OS? Most of us use OS X’s stock interface elements, arranged as they were out of the box. But you don’t have to use someone else’s workspace. Here’s how some Mac users have customized the Mac’s visual environment. Move the Dock It has always puzzled me that OS X puts the Dock at the bottom of the screen by default.

Max the Dock I’ve wholeheartedly embraced the Dock—but I use it very methodically. Replace the Dock I’ve used James Thomson’s $29 DragThing instead of the Dock for years. DragThing has helped me keep my desktop organized: I created an Important Files folder in my Documents folder; in it, I put twelve subfolders that can accommodate just about any kind of file I’d normally leave on the desktop—work files and folders, in-progress projects, podcasts, pictures, audio files, and download archives I want to hang on to. 1. 2. 3. 4.
